Christopher Donaldson
Vice President of Government Relations
Chris has 19+ years in civilian and military law enforcement. Chris has served as the Protection Non-Commissioned Officer in Charge (NCOIC) of the largest Expeditionary Sustainment Command (ESC) in the United States Army. Chris specializes in anti-terrorism vulnerability, threat assessments, hostile vehicle mitigation, and physical security threat mitigation development. Chris was honored in 2018 as the counter-terrorism professional of the year by the U.S. Army.

Benjamin Tolle
Vice President of Strategic Accounts
Benjamin spent 11 years as a Soldier in the United States Army. While on Active Duty, Tolle served in the 101st Airborne and as a Green Beret in the United States Army Special Forces where he executed and supported numerous combat and contingency operations across the globe. Upon his transition from the Army, Ben went on to Co-Found a Counterterrorism, Safety, and Security firm focused on supporting clients in the live sports and entertainment industries. His professional associations include InfraGuard and the Pacific Council. Tolle currently resides in Santa Rosa Beach, Florida.

Christopher Sublett
Senior Estimator
Chris has over 20 years of experience in the construction industry with a primary focus in estimating and project management of commercial projects at the senior level. He has worked on various types of commercial projects including office, retail, healthcare, industrial, and educational. In addition to working in the capacity of a general commercial contractor, Chris has also spent over two years of his career working as a senior estimator and project manager for a commercial concrete contractor. During his time as a concrete contractor, Chris has estimated and project managed various types of concrete structures and building methods including drilled piers, earthen formed foundations, formed foundations, slab on grade, slab on deck, retaining walls, tilt walls, and post tension parking and building structures. Chris holds a Bachelor of Science in Construction Management from the University of Arkansas at Little Rock. He has also served as past-president of American Society of Professional Estimators-Chapter 33.
